On average Smith's Wood South has very high deprivation and high crime levels, with around 91 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. Approximately 38.7% of homes in this area are social housing provided by a local council or housing association. The average income per household in Smith's Wood South is £42,694 per year. There are 7 schools in Smith's Wood South: 4 primary (1 Outstanding and 1 Good) and 1 secondary (0 Outstanding and 0 Good). Smith's Wood South is home to around 6,746 people, with a population density of about 4,625.3 per km2.
Based on 52 recent sales, the median property price is £225,000 in Smith's Wood South area, with individual transactions ranging from £115,000 up to £430,000.

Median sale price and percentiles per property type (last year)
| Type | Sales | Median |
|---|---|---|
| Detached | 3 | £290,000 |
| Flats | 5 | £134,500 |
| Semi-Detached | 21 | £252,000 |
| Terraced | 23 | £195,000 |
